This review is based solely on Subway’s published allergen information. It reflects what the chain reports about the presence or possible cross-contact of the 14 major allergens. Please check Subway’s official allergen guide directly, as ingredients and preparation practices may change. Subway states clearly that allergens are handled in-store and that they “can never 100% guarantee that products will be allergen free” due to cross contact in preparation areas (page header). The allergen tables show many menu items containing gluten (wheat, barley, rye, oat, spelt), particularly across nearly all breads, wraps and cookies. Milk is also widely present in cheeses, sauces, cookies, donuts and hot drinks. The allergen grid includes both direct ingredients (“Y”) and “may contain” risks (“MC”), especially for nuts, peanuts and gluten in desserts. Cross-contact risk is further reinforced where plant-based ingredients may come into contact with non-plant-based items. Many sauces and proteins contain mustard, soya, and egg, and cookies and muffins frequently show nut or may-contain nut indicators. Tuna subs contain fish, and soups show varied allergens depending on recipe. The chain’s allergen guide notes that cross-contact may occur in shared preparation areas. Menu variability note: Allergen information may differ by region or location, so customers should verify details for their specific restaurant. Information reviewed as of: January 2021 (document date).
